A security vulnerability has been detected in Tenda CP3 27.5.57.101. Impacted is an unknown function of the file custom-x/softap/hostapd. Such manipulation of the argument wpa_passphrase leads to hard-coded credentials.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ed publicly and may be used.
A weakness has been identified in Tenda CP3 27.5.57.101. This issue affects some unknown processing of the file Net/NetCheckPing.cpp. This manipulation of the argument interface_name/host causes os command injection. The attack can be initiated remotely.
A security flaw has been discovered in Tenda CP3 27.5.57.101. This vulnerability affects the function SystemAsh of the file Apis/system.c of the component Kylin. The manipulation of the argument AlarmVoiceURL results in os command injection. It is possible to launch the attack remotely.

RouterOS contains an argument-handling flaw in the SSH login path involving usernames that begin with a prohibited character, allowing for the trusted RouterOS policy mask to be changed, leading to privilege escalation. Exploitation requires an unauthenticated SSH session to reach the RouterOS login helper.This issue was fixed in versions: 6.49.21 (Long-term), 7.23.4 (Long-term) and 7.24.2 (Stable)
